Eligibility criteria for RTO Exam

What is the minimum eligibility required to appear for RTO examinations???

RTO examinations are generally conducted by public service commission of each state of India.

RTO Examination Judicial service post eligibility criteria
-Age should be above 23 year and should be below 34 years.
- You should be a citizen of India.
- You should hold degree in law from any standard or recognized university.
- You should be capable to read, write and speak particular state’s language.

RTO examination clerkship post eligibility criteria
- You should be a citizen of India.
- You should have an educational qualification Secondary education or equivalent from the respective state board.
-The age of the candidate should be between 18 years old and should not cross 37 year old.

RTO examination sub assistant engineer eligibility criteria
- You should be an Indian citizen.
- You should have a degree in engineering like in civil, mechanical or in electrical.
-The age of the candidate should not cross 32years.
